About

Qiang Bie is a scholar working on Global and Planetary Change, Ecology and Atmospheric Science. According to data from OpenAlex, Qiang Bie has authored 27 papers receiving a total of 385 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Global and Planetary Change, 13 papers in Ecology and 12 papers in Atmospheric Science. Recurrent topics in Qiang Bie's work include Land Use and Ecosystem Services (16 papers), Remote Sensing in Agriculture (10 papers) and Remote Sensing and Land Use (8 papers). Qiang Bie is often cited by papers focused on Land Use and Ecosystem Services (16 papers), Remote Sensing in Agriculture (10 papers) and Remote Sensing and Land Use (8 papers). Qiang Bie collaborates with scholars based in China, United States and Australia. Qiang Bie's co-authors include Yaowen Xie, Xiaoyun Wang, Lei He, Wenli Qiang, Zecheng Guo, Jizong Jiao, Thomas Kästner, Shuwen Niu, Shengkui Cheng and Xiang Wang and has published in prestigious journals such as The Science of The Total Environment, Journal of Cleaner Production and Scientific Reports.
